WebDegenerative disc disease is a condition that is categorized by a gradual deterioration and thinning of the shock-absorbing intervertebral discs in your spine. In some cases, disc generation is contained to one overstressed disc, but more often, disc degeneration occurs at multiple levels throughout the spine. WebWhat are degenerative changes of the thoracic spine? “Degenerative changes of the spine” is the same condition as spinal osteoarthritis, spondylosis and degenerative disk disease. With age, the soft disks that act as cushions between your spine’s vertebrae wear down, dry out and/or shrink.

WebThoracic degenerative disc disease refers to the degeneration, or breakdown, of the shock-absorbing intervertebral discs that cushion the vertebrae in the upper and middle back (called the thoracic spine). It develops most frequently in middle-aged people or young adults with active lifestyles. It appears that the aging process, trauma, and ...
